Our Story
Founded in 1976 by Marty Abrams, a former school teacher in Brooklyn, Junior Tours has always operated as a family run business. In 2012, Junior Tours acquired Manhattan Tour & Travel, another family owned Tour Company who focused solely on planning Theatre Art Tours in New York City. The merger created many opportunities for all our clients who benefit from greater organizational resources.

The Student & Youth Travel Association (SYTA) – SYTA is the non-profit, professional trade association that promotes student & youth travel and seeks to foster integrity and professionalism among student and youth travel service providers. All companies listed have met criteria and adhere to SYTA’s Purposes and Goals and Code of Ethics. Visit SYTA online at www.syta.org.

National Tour Association (“NTA”) – Junior Tours has been a member of the NTA since 1983. NTA is an organization of nearly 4,000 tourism professionals focused on the development, promotion and increased use of tour operator-packaged travel. NTA serves as a consumer advocate through membership requirements and education. For more information on NTA visit their website at www.ntaonline.com.
